The SMBJ43A is a part of the SMBJ series of surface mount transient voltage suppressor diodes. These diodes are designed to protect sensitive electronic components from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.

The SMBJ43A operates based on the principle of avalanche breakdown. When a transient voltage surge occurs, the diode rapidly conducts excess current, limiting the voltage across the protected circuit.
The SMBJ43A is commonly used in various electronic systems, including: - Telecommunication equipment - Industrial control systems - Automotive electronics - Consumer electronics
